Abstract
Collection consists of one account book, specifications for steamships, drawings of steamships, and photographs of the company's shipyard in Coos Bay. The specifications include the hulls of seven steamers, along with a few other specifications for other.

Biographical/Historical note
The Kruse and Banks Shipbuilding Company was established in 1905 in Coos Bay, Oregon. Robert Banks was taken as partner by K. V. Kruse to form the company. Located in Coos Bay, the Kruse and Banks Company produced wooden ships. The company became a leader.
